Understanding Airbags

Airbags serve a critical function in vehicle safety, helping to protect occupants during a crash. Proper functioning hinges on the correct inflation level of the airbag, ensuring it deploys when needed.

Function of Airbags

Airbags inflate rapidly upon collision, cushioning passengers and minimizing injuries. They work alongside seatbelts, reducing the force of impact. During a frontal collision, for example, the airbag deploys within milliseconds to create a barrier between the occupant and the dashboard, protecting vital areas like the head and torso.
